为提高甘蔗联合收获机对不同收获天气、不同甘蔗疏密程度,以及不同收获地形的适应性,将甘蔗联合收获机的收获工况分为晴天收获、雨天收获、甘蔗密度较疏收获、甘蔗密度较密收获、上坡收获和下坡收获 6 种工况,并对其关键机构进行功耗研究。田间试验结果可为甘蔗联合收获机的动力系统设计和动力分配提供依据。
Effect of Harvesting Conditions on Power Consumption of Key Mechanisms of Sugarcane Combine Harvester
In order to improve the adaptability of sugarcane combine harvester to different harvesting weather,different sugarcane sparseness and different harvesting terrain,we divided the harvesting conditions of the sugarcane combine har-vester into six conditions:sunny harvesting,rainy harvesting,sparse sugarcane density harvesting,dense sugarcane den-sity harvesting,upslope harvesting and downslope harvesting,and studied the power consumption of its key components by conditions.The results of field tests in this paper can provide a basis for the power system design and power distribu-tion of the sugarcane combine harvester.
